Identifying the defendant
Unlike typical car accident cases, truck accidents may involve multiple parties. It is important to determine all of the liable parties in your case, so that you can claim the maximum amount of compensation for your injuries and losses.
It's not always easy to determine the root of an accident involving a truck. However you can get a clear picture of what happened employing investigative methods specifically designed for this type of case. There is also a large variety of witnesses and records that you can use to support your claim.
Driver mistakes are the main reason behind truck accidents. Driver error is the most frequent cause of truck accidents.
Another cause for truck crashes is a defect in the component. A damaged or defective part that results in an accident is the fault of the manufacturer. Maintenance companies may also be held responsible for failing to fix the problem or replacing the component.
A team of experts in accident reconstruction will study the exact spot where the accident occurred and document eyewitness reports sight lines, and skid marks, along with other elements. They also collect data from the vehicle's "black box" and its electronic logging devices as well as documents relating to maintenance reports, cargo loading manifests, hours-of-service for truck drivers, logs, and communication systems.
It is essential to collect this information before litigation begins. Defense attorneys hide information from the plaintiffs. This information can include the schedule and route of the company, satellite tracking information, and communications with their home base regarding the incident.

Identifying the injuries
The injuries you suffer as a result of the event of a truck crash are usually severe, and can have lasting consequences for your life. You might not be able to work and perform everyday tasks, leaving you feeling angry and depressed.
Broken bones, whiplash and head trauma are the most common injuries that you could sustain during a collision with a truck. Bone fractures are a common occurrence in truck crashes because of the force of the collision. These fractures require surgery, casts and physical therapy to heal. They can take several months to heal and can have long-lasting negative effects on your health.
Burns are a different type of injury that can be caused by the collision of a truck. The tank of fuel for trucks is more likely to rupture during a collision than in passenger vehicles, which could result in fires.
Burns can be painful and may cause permanent disfigurement if you've suffered from an accident with a truck. If you suffered serious burns, you may need reconstructive surgery in order to restore your skin and face.
Another type of common accident-related truck injury is spinal cord injuries. The sudden impact on the spinal cord can cause permanent damage to your feel, think and move.
